RIP Jim Brown

Last time I saw him on 100 Rifles (1969), together with Raquel Welch in what was then a very risquee affair.

Now I caught-up with the heist film from 1968 The Split, one of his first leading roles. 

Jim Brown was a great NFL player, the first one to swap the field for Hollywood. He died on May 18th (same day as Helmut Berger) of natural causes. Jim Brown was 87. 

Acting highlights:

Dark of the Sun (1968) aka The Mercenaries

Ice Station Zebra (1968)

El Condor (1970) can be watched on youtube here. with Lee Van Cleef

Slaughter (1972) and its sequel Slaughter's Big Rip-off (1973)-blaxploitation

blaxploitation classic: Three the Hard Way (1974) with Fred Williamson and Jim Kelly

Take a Hard Ride (1975) one more time with Lee Van Cleef, Fred Williamson and Jim Kelly

Fingers (1978), James Toback's maligned underrated and still unknown masterpiece.

The Running Man, I'm Gonna Git You Sucka, Mars Attacks!, Any Given Sunday, Small Soldiers (voice).
